Greater contact area

Some conventional oval section chain links start with a virtual point contact area, which immediately begins to wear at this point of contact.

After studying wear patterns in the field we noticed that most chain wear takes place at the link contact areas. The solution: Columbia Steel’s integrally cast XtraLife chain with extra bearing area for extra long life. XtraLife chain’s additional ridge of metal is far greater than that of oval chains. Wearing stresses are distributed rather than concentrated. The result is longer link life and fewer premature stress failures.

A proven endurance winner

In tests in a major Western U.S. coal mine, our XtraLife chain moved 11.8 million cubic yards of overburden, compared to 7.5 MMCY for the previous chain. Other locations are having similar results with Columbia XtraLife chain.
